A two-part brief for a young family in the Illawarra. At the front, poor access and no street appeal. At the rear, a split-level yard that wasn't being used.
The front was resolved with a meandering staircase through a low-maintenance native garden, planted in an organic style that suits the coastal character of the street and requires minimal upkeep.
In the upper backyard, we cleared unusable space and overgrown fruit trees to create an open lawn area for the kids, with a fire pit seating zone tucked into the corner for the cooler months the Illawarra actually gets.
On the lower level, a roofed outdoor kitchen with a custom in-situ setup covers two cooking styles. The client wanted both a standard grill and a smoker. The roof turns it into a year-round space.

A renovated cottage in Mount Ousley with two distinct architectural halves, a retained traditional facade at the front and a fully renovated contemporary extension at the rear. The landscape design was built to complement both.
At the front, the priority was creating a safe, enclosed play space for the young family. Simple fencing defines the yard without overpowering the cottage character, with a classic, considered planting palette that suits the style of the street.
The backyard is designed around a small pool, positioned carefully to preserve the views out to the parklands behind the property. Rather than filling the space, the design keeps it open and relaxed, a yard built for entertaining, for unwinding, and for a young family to actually use over the years ahead.
The material and planting choices carry a consistent thread from front to back, tying the two halves of the property together into something that feels whole rather than renovated in stages.

A front and backyard landscape design for a new build tucked away in the hills of Bulli, one of the Illawarra's most sought-after escarpment suburbs.
At the front, the brief was straightforward. Retain the slope, create a level entry area and frame it with screening plantings that complement the architecture without competing with it.
The backyard centred on fitting a pool into a constrained site between the house and the boundaries, while levelling the entire yard to make it genuinely usable. The pool is designed with ample space for lounging on both sides, functioning as an outdoor living zone rather than a lap pool squeezed into a corner.
Off the pool, a continuous retaining wall holds the neighbouring boundary and doubles as a built-in in-situ concrete bench seat. A circular cutout in the wall is positioned around a feature tree, making it the focal point of the whole space.

A brand new architectural build in Towradgi, designed around the client's love of tropical living, lush greenery and the coastal character that makes the Illawarra an ideal setting for this style.
At the front, the facade was transformed with rich green planting, a cobblestone driveway, stone cladding to the exterior and a custom feature letterbox. The centrepiece is a large palm tree growing through an opening in the roof structure, the kind of detail that makes a property genuinely memorable on the street.
The backyard carried the same tropical thread through to the pool, already incorporated into the build. Materials and planting were selected to tie the whole project together as a single cohesive space rather than a house with a garden attached. Large expanses of turf give the young family room to move, with the pool sitting at the heart of an outdoor living zone that feels more coastal resort than suburban backyard.

What is a CDC?:
The fast-track approval pathway for projects that meet set council criteria, assessed by an Accredited Certifier rather than going through a full council DA with Wollongong City Council
What’s included in the CDC Package?:
A detailed CDC documentation set tailored for submission to an Accredited Certifier or Private Certifying Authority via the NSW Planning Portal, covering Wollongong. This includes all necessary plans and paperwork. For any additional compliance matters identified during assessment, we recommend involving external consultants (fees not included).Your completed CDC package includes:
Everything outlined in the Concept Design Package, plus:Project elevation plans suitable for submittance
Completed Sediment and Erosion Plan
Site and Stormwater Management Plan

What is a DA?
The full council assessment pathway required when a project doesn't meet complying development criteria and needs formal approval from Wollongong City Council.What’s included in the DA Package?:
A complete DA documentation set tailored for lodgement with Wollongong City Council via the NSW Planning Portal. This includes the required plans, supporting documentation and an assessment of compliance matters for your proposed works.Your completed DA package includes:
Site plan and legislative compliance table / site calculations @1:200
Detailed dimensioned plan set suitable for submittance
Proposed planting plans and schedules
2 x project elevation plans suitable for submittance
Completed Sediment and Erosion Plan
Site and Stormwater Management Plan
